As the object moves from point A to point D across the surface, the sum of its gravitational potential and kinetic energies ____.a. decreases, onlyb. decreases and then increasesc. increases and then decreasesd. remains the same

Respuesta :

Answer:

d. remains the same

Explanation:

We know that if there is no external resistive force then the total energy of the system remains constant.

The total energy is the summation of kinetic and potential energy.

When an object moves from point A to another point D then the total energy, potential gravitational and kinetic energy will remain same.

Therefore the answer is d.

Answer:

D. remains the same

Explanation:

Here we need to mention the conservation of energy theorem, which states that energy cannot be created or destroyed, just transformed. In other words, the total energy of a system is constant, or the sum of potential and kinetic energy is always constant.

This conservation of energy is possible because when the kinetic energy decreases, the potential energy increases, that's why the sum of them is always constant.

However, there's a case where the total energy is not constant, where there are non conservative forces, like force due to friction, this type of forces subtract energy from the system, which means it won't be constant.

So, assuming that the statements refers to conservative forces only, the right answer is D. remaing the same.
